7 /** | |
8 * Returns whether two objects are structurally equivalent. This considers NaN | |
9 * values to be equivalent. It also handles self-referential structures. | |
10 */ | |
11 bool deepEquals(obj1, obj2, [List parents1, List parents2]) { | |
12 if (identical(obj1, obj2)) return true; | |
13 if (parents1 == null) { | |
14 parents1 = []; | |
15 parents2 = []; | |
16 } | |
17 | |
18 // parents1 and parents2 are guaranteed to be the same size. | |
19 for (var i = 0; i < parents1.length; i++) { | |
20 var loop1 = identical(obj1, parents1[i]); | |
21 var loop2 = identical(obj2, parents2[i]); | |
22 // If both structures loop in the same place, they're equal at that point in | |
23 // the structure. If one loops and the other doesn't, they're not equal. | |
24 if (loop1 && loop2) return true; | |
25 if (loop1 || loop2) return false; | |
26 } | |
27 | |
28 parents1.add(obj1); | |
29 parents2.add(obj2); | |
30 try { | |
31 if (obj1 is List && obj2 is List) { | |
32 return _listEquals(obj1, obj2, parents1, parents2); | |
33 } else if (obj1 is Map && obj2 is Map) { | |
34 return _mapEquals(obj1, obj2, parents1, parents2); | |
35 } else if (obj1 is double && obj2 is double) { | |
36 return _doubleEquals(obj1, obj2); | |
37 } else { | |
38 return obj1 == obj2; | |
39 } | |
40 } finally { | |
41 parents1.removeLast(); | |
42 parents2.removeLast(); | |
43 } | |
44 } | |
45 | |
46 /** Returns whether [list1] and [list2] are structurally equal. */ | |
47 bool _listEquals(List list1, List list2, List parents1, List parents2) { | |
48 if (list1.length != list2.length) return false; | |
49 | |
50 for (var i = 0; i < list1.length; i++) { | |
51 if (!deepEquals(list1[i], list2[i], parents1, parents2)) return false; | |
52 } | |
53 | |
54 return true; | |
55 } | |
56 | |
57 /** Returns whether [map1] and [map2] are structurally equal. */ | |
58 bool _mapEquals(Map map1, Map map2, List parents1, List parents2) { | |
59 if (map1.length != map2.length) return false; | |
60 | |
61 for (var key in map1.keys) { | |
62 if (!map2.containsKey(key)) return false; | |
63 if (!deepEquals(map1[key], map2[key], parents1, parents2)) return false; | |
64 } | |
65 | |
66 return true; | |
67 } | |
68 | |
69 /** | |
70 * Returns whether two doubles are equivalent. This differs from `d1 == d2` in | |
71 * that it considers NaN to be equal to itself. | |
72 */ | |
73 bool _doubleEquals(double d1, double d2) { | |
74 if (d1.isNaN && d2.isNaN) return true; | |
75 return d1 == d2; | |
76 } | |
